Key Responsibilities:
Test Development & Validation
o Design, develop, Sustain and validate functional tester, test fixtures, and equipment for PCBA and system level testing.
o Create and execute validation protocols (IQ, OQ, PQ, TMV) to meet medical device regulatory requirements.
o Perform root cause analysis and troubleshooting of test failures, ensuring corrective actions are implemented.
Compliance & Documentation
o Ensure all test processes comply with ISO 13485, FDA 21 CFR Part 820 standards.
o Maintain technical documentation, test reports, and evidence for audits and regulatory inspections.
o Support risk management activities and contribute to Design for Test (DFT) reviews.
Production Support
o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Program, Quality, Manufacturing) to integrate test systems into production lines.
o Monitor tester performance, yield, and cycle time, drive continuous improvement initiatives.
o Support factory acceptance tests (FAT) and site acceptance tests (SAT) for new equipment before release to production.
Supplier & Stakeholder Engagement
o Work with suppliers on tester design, fixture procurement, and instrumentation readiness.
o Provide technical support to customers and internal stakeholders regarding test requirements and implementation.
Requirements:
Degree/Diploma in Electrical/Electronics Engineering or related field.
Experience in medical device manufacturing or regulated industries.
Strong knowledge of automated test equipment (ATE, ICT, FCT) and data analysis tools.
Familiarity with regulatory compliance standards (ISO 13485, FDA, IEC).
Skills in project management, documentation, and cross-functional collaboration
